Overview

Not all fairies are sweet and pink . . . some are Little Horrors!

Flax Lilykicker is a young bad fairy who has somehow ended up in Miss Kisses' Academy of Sweetness for Little Fairiesâ€â€Âand Miss Kisses is determined to give her a pink makeover. What's a bad fairy to do? Her plan is to earn a Badge of Badness, and get into a school for bad fairies. Together with her new friend the dog-face, Flax hatches a plan that's badder than bad. But will it all work out bad in the end?

Author Biography

Tiffany Mandrake lives in a cozy, creepy cottage in the grounds of Hagâ€ââ€ΕΎÂ¢s Abademy, where bad fairies go to study badness. Martin Chatterton is well-known as both a writer and an illustrator of titles for children. His works include Yuck! The Grossest Joke Book Ever and the popular Bad Dog books.
